DC vs MI Preview

Shreyas Iyer-led Delhi Capitals will take on defending champions Mumbai Indians in match 51 of Indian Premier League (IPL) 2020. The two sides will lock horns at the Dubai International Cricket Stadium, Dubai on October 31 (Saturday) from 3:30 PM (IST) onwards. This game will be the first one of the double-header hosted on the same day.

Mumbai Indians registered a comfortable victory when these two teams last met in this year’s IPL season. Quinton de Kock and Suryakumar Yadav slammed half-centuries for the Mumbai-based franchise while chasing the target of 163, set by DC.

Delhi Capitals (DC)

Delhi Capitals

After registering seven wins in nine matches, the Capitals went through a downslide in IPL 2020. Shreyas Iyer and co suffered three consecutive losses against Kings XI Punjab, Kolkata Knight Riders and Sunrisers Hyderabad in their previous matches. 

Currently, the momentum is shifting away from their dugout, and they will be under pressure to register a victory in this encounter. Moreover, Delhi’s bowling also leaked many runs in their last two games, adding to their vows in this season. They are expected to make one or two changes in this game to find their lost mojo back in this edition.

Mumbai Indians (MI)

MI Players

Mumbai Indians have played like the best side of the season in IPL 2020. After Chennai Super Kings’ victory over Kolkata Knight Riders in the last match, MI also became the first team to make it to the playoffs. 

With eight wins in 12 games, MI Paltan holds the pole position in the Points Table. But there is still no update on Rohit Sharma’s injury, so he will continue remaining out. As a result, Kieron Pollard will lead their side, and Mumbai will take the field with the same playing XI.

Head-to-Head

  • Total matches played: 25
  • DC won: 12
  • MI won: 13
  • No Result: 0
  • Tie: 0
